About This Item
London: F Warne & Co Ltd, 1980. One of the most collectable series of books around this is the rare Devon and Cornwall edition (RARE, even down here everyone wants to keep their copy until death) Slight discolouration to boards 184pp including index A nice tidy clean copy .. Ex Avon Library (one Stamp on Title pg). 1980 This is the First Edition 1285-879. Laminated Boards. VERY GOOD ( AVERAGE)/No Jacket Issued. Illus. by 8 Colour Photographs .50 Black and White Photos and Line Illustrations(maps). 24mo - over 5" - 5¾". HARDBACK.
